Softeners Water softeners could possibly be Situated both upstream or downstream of disinfectant removal models. They utilize sodium-centered cation-Trade resins to remove water-hardness ions, such as calcium and magnesium, that can foul or interfere Using the overall performance of downstream processing tools which include reverse osmosis membranes, deionization products, and distillation models. Water softeners will also be used to remove other decrease affinity cations, like the ammonium ion, Which might be introduced from chloramine disinfectants commonly used in ingesting water and which might normally carryover by way of other downstream device functions. If ammonium removal is among its purposes, the softener have to be located downstream with the disinfectant removing Procedure, which itself might liberate ammonium from neutralized chloramine disinfectants. Water softener resin beds are regenerated with concentrated sodium chloride Alternative (brine).

Activated Carbon Granular activated carbon beds adsorb low molecular excess weight natural materials and oxidizing additives, for example chlorine and chloramine compounds, removing them from the water. These are used to realize sure excellent characteristics and to safeguard versus reaction with downstream stainless-steel surfaces, resins, and membranes. The Main working problems with regards to activated carbon beds involve the propensity to assistance microorganisms growth, the opportunity for hydraulic channeling, the organic and natural adsorption potential, suitable water stream prices and phone time, The shortcoming for being regenerated in situ, along with the shedding of bacteria, endotoxins, natural chemical compounds, and good carbon particles. Regulate measures could contain monitoring water movement prices and differential pressures, sanitizing with hot water or steam, backwashing, tests for adsorption capability, and Regular substitute in the carbon mattress. In the event the activated carbon bed is intended for organic reduction, it may also be ideal to observe influent and effluent TOC. It's important to note that the usage of steam for carbon mattress sanitization is usually incompletely effective because of steam channeling rather then even permeation in the mattress.

Sterile Water for Injection is packaged in single-dose containers not bigger than one L in dimension. Bacteriostatic Water for Injection — Bacteriostatic Water for Injection (see USP monograph) is sterile Water for Injection to which has been additional a number of acceptable antimicrobial preservatives. It is intended being used to be a diluent inside the planning of parenteral products and solutions, most ordinarily for multi-dose products that call for recurring material withdrawals. It might be packaged in single-dose or numerous-dose containers not larger than 30 mL. Sterile Water for Irrigation— Sterile Water for Irrigation (see USP monograph) is Water for Injection packaged and sterilized in single-dose containers of more substantial than 1 L in dimensions that enables rapid supply of its contents. It need not satisfy the necessity under website compact-volume injections in the overall exam chapter Particulate Make a difference in Injections
